迁移ZBlogPHP网站至新服务器涉及多个步骤,备份当前网站数据,详细记录旧服务器上的设置和配置,将网站文件和新数据库迁移到新服务器上,并修改相关配置文件以适应新环境,在完成迁移后,进行全面测试以确保所有功能正常运行,更新DNS设置,将新域名指向新服务器的IP地址,整个过程需要耐心和细致的操作,确保每一步都正确无误。
在数字化转型浪潮中,网站迁移是一项关键技术挑战,尤其对于运行在虚拟主机或共享主机上的博客平台而言,更是不可或缺的一环,本文旨在详细解析如何将基于ZBlogPHP框架的网站顺利迁移到新服务器上。
准备工作
迁移的第一步是做好充足的准备工作,这包括但不限于:
-
新服务器环境评估:详细检查新服务器硬件配置、操作系统版本、Web服务器软件以及数据库等环境要素。
-
目标服务器备份:在新服务器上执行完整的备份操作,确保旧服务器上的所有数据和配置信息得到妥善保存。
-
ZBlogPHP版本确认:核实当前使用的ZBlogPHP版本,并在必要时升级至最新稳定版。
-
迁移策略制定:结合具体情况制定切实可行的迁移方案,包括时间安排、人员分工和资源调配等。
数据备份与恢复
数据备份是确保数据安全的关键环节,需要格外重视:
-
数据库备份:利用数据库管理工具,对ZBlogPHP的所有数据库进行完整备份。
-
文件备份:对网站的全部文件和目录结构进行详尽备份。
-
备份验证:在正式迁移前,对备份数据进行彻底恢复测试,以确保备份的完整性和可用性。
文件传输与配置调整
文件传输和服务器配置调整是迁移过程中的核心步骤:
-
FTP工具选择:选用如FileZilla等专业FTP工具进行文件的上传和下载操作。
-
路径结构调整:根据新服务器的环境,对网站文件的路径进行必要的调整。
-
数据库迁移与设置:在新服务器上创建与旧服务器相同的数据库,并导入备份数据,修改数据库配置信息以适配新服务器环境。
-
服务器设置与调试:配置Web服务器(如Apache)和数据库(如MySQL),确保网站能够正常解析URL、连接数据库并运行。
功能测试与性能优化
完成上述步骤后,需要进行全面的测试来确保网站的正常运行:
-
功能测试:逐一验证网站各项功能的正确性和稳定性。
-
性能测试:使用工具模拟真实负载情况对网站进行压力测试和性能调优。
-
安全检查:仔细检查网站是否存在安全隐患,并采取相应的防护措施。
迁移完成后,应密切监控网站的运行状况,并定期进行数据备份和性能优化工作,以确保网站能够持续稳定地运营。


还没有评论,来说两句吧...